Book Description
Susan J. Miller's father's heroin addiction was only one of the unacknowledged pathologies that scarred her childhood, examined in Never Let Me Down with remarkable reflectiveness. Miller recognizes the seductiveness of the pleasure her father experienced listening to jazz and doing drugs even as she exposes the havoc it wrought on her overwhelmed mother and desperate brother, who vented his ...
